Why a template website quietly costs you customers
A website is not an online brochure. It is your first salesperson, your first filter, your first quality signal. When a prospect lands on a generic template, they feel it within seconds, and so does your conversion rate.
Most SMBs settle for a template because it looks fast and cheap. The hidden cost shows up later: slow load times, weak SEO foundations, copy that says nothing specific, and a structure that fights your sales process instead of serving it.
A custom website fixes the root cause. The architecture, the design, and the technical stack are all shaped around how your clients actually decide and buy.
- Templates load heavy code you never use, which hurts speed and SEO.
- Generic layouts force your business into someone else's structure.
- Off-the-shelf copy reads the same as every competitor in your market.
- Editing or scaling a template later often costs more than building right once.

Who custom website development is for
Custom websites make sense when your site has a real job: generating leads, qualifying clients, or showcasing work that justifies a premium. That is most Swiss SMBs and growing commercial companies past the hobby stage. Think of a real estate agency that needs live listings tied to a CRM, a service business whose reputation rests on how the site feels, or a growing company that outgrew the first theme it shipped on.
These are the situations where the structure of the site directly shapes revenue. A property portal lives or dies on filtered search and fast pages. A premium service brand loses trust the moment the design looks borrowed. A growing company needs a stack that adds pages, languages, and integrations without a rebuild.
If you are testing a one weekend idea with zero budget, a template is fine. If your website is part of how you win and keep clients, custom is the responsible choice.

Template website vs custom website
| Template website | Custom website (MAWT) |
|---|---|
| Generic layout shared by thousands of sites | Architecture designed around your funnels |
| Heavy unused code, slower load times | Lean performant stack, fast by design |
| SEO bolted on afterward | SEO friendly foundations from day one |
| Limited or costly customization later | Built to evolve with short iterations |
| You adapt your business to the theme | The site adapts to how you sell |
